peekaboo card with awesome otters

Peekaboo card – Awesome otters

Peekaboo card with Awesome otters. I slipped up big time. A video had been prepared, scheduled and uploaded on my YouTube channel, but with the madness over Christmas and having house guests, I forgot to schedule this post! Eek – notice the mistake in the photo? I didn’t do it just once, but I did […]